How Mobile Data Is Consumed at Instaspin Casino
Instaspin Casino functions entirely through a mobile-optimized web interface. Every spin, animation, and sound file is loaded incrementally from remote servers rather than from local storage. This architecture holds the initial page weight low but creates continuous background requests that gather over time. A typical session fetches game assets, transmits bet outcomes, refreshes lobby thumbnails, and occasionally retrieves promotional banners. No of these operations is substantial individually, but their aggregate effect on a limited data plan can be unexpected after a few evenings of casual play.
Content Loading Patterns During Gameplay
When a player launches a slot title at Instaspin Casino, the browser fetches a compressed package of symbols, background images, and sound sprites. The size of this initial payload changes by provider. Pragmatic Play titles often load a 12–18 MB bundle, while smaller studios may deliver 6–10 MB. After the first spin, only incremental data goes between the device and the game server. However, moving between three or four titles in a single session increases the data footprint because each game initiates its own fresh asset download.
Actual Dealer Tables and Streaming Overhead
Live dealer casino sections bring an completely different data profile. A real-time blackjack or roulette stream at Instaspin Casino uses adaptive bitrate technology that adjusts video quality based on connection speed. On a stable 4G network, the stream typically settles at 720p resolution, consuming approximately 1.2 GB per hour. On 5G, the encoder may push 1080p, which rises closer to 1.8 GB hourly. Audio alone contributes 60–80 MB per hour. For data cap users, a 30-minute live dealer session can erase 600–900 MB, making it the absolute most data-heavy activity on the platform from a data perspective.
Background Data Usage Between Spins
Not all data usage at Instaspin Casino is visible or deliberate. The platform regularly pings analytics endpoints, updates session tokens, and scans for new promotions even when the screen seems idle. These background calls are minor, typically 50–200 KB each, but they occur every 30–90 seconds. Over a two-hour session, background chatter alone can accumulate 40–80 MB. Players who have a browser tab open while managing other things may unknowingly burn through a significant slice of their monthly allowance without putting a single bet.

Browser Cache Performance and Its Limits
Modern mobile browsers store game assets in cache after the first load. If a player goes back to the same slot title within the same day, the browser retrieves most images and sounds from local storage rather than re-downloading them. This can reduce reload data by 60–80%. However, cache storage is limited, and mobile operating systems frequently delete browser caches when storage pressure grows. A player who switches between many titles or plays rarely may find that the cache benefit is variable. Depending on cache alone is not a dependable data strategy.
Manual Play vs. Autoplay Data Implications
Autoplay mode at Instaspin Casino sends the same amount of data per spin as manual play, but it raises the spin frequency dramatically. A player clicking manually might finish 150 spins per hour. Autoplay set to fast turbo mode can push 600–800 spins in the same period. The per-spin data cost remains unchanged, but the total hourly consumption grows by four or five. For a user on a limited plan, disabling autoplay is one of the simplest and most powerful data-saving actions possible, requiring no technical configuration and producing instant measurable results.

Carrier Throttling and Its Impact on Gameplay
Canadian carriers like Rogers, Bell, and Telus enforce throttling once a subscriber exceeds their plan cap. Throttled speeds typically drop to 512 Kbps or lower, which is sufficient for text and email but harsh for real-time gaming. At 512 Kbps, Instaspin Casino slot games remain technically playable but experience from extended load times and occasional spin delays. Live dealer streams become impossible to watch, defaulting to the lowest bitrate tier or failing entirely. The platform does not dictate this outcome; it simply provides what the connection can accept, and on a throttled pipe, that is often not enough for a smooth experience.
Spotting the Signs of a Throttled Connection
A player on a throttled connection will observe game thumbnails loading slowly, spin animations stuttering, and live dealer feeds buffering every 15–20 seconds. These symptoms are not platform bugs—they are bandwidth starvation indicators. Instaspin Casino’s servers remain to respond normally, but the data packets reach the device in a trickle rather than a stream. The most practical response is to exit live dealer sections immediately and switch to low-bandwidth slot titles with simpler animations. Some older game releases feature static backgrounds and minimal particle effects, making them far more tolerant on degraded connections.

Does a VPN reduce data consumption at Instaspin Casino?
A VPN doesn’t reduce data consumption; it typically increases it by 5–15% due to encryption overhead and additional packet headers. While a VPN can help with privacy and geo-location concerns, it brings extra bytes to every transmission. Limited plan users should be aware that routing Instaspin Casino traffic through a VPN will slightly hasten data depletion rather than slow it down.
